If you're looking for a service that uses AI to assess the risks and potential problems in software design, Metabob is a good option. The company's graph-attention networks and generative AI tools are designed to help with code review, refactoring and debugging to improve software security and quality. Metabob offers AI code review, software security scanning and integration with common development tools, with a free individual developer plan and paid options starting at $20 per month per developer.
Another contender is Sonar, which can help ensure high-quality, secure code regardless of whether it's written by humans or generated by AI. It offers in-IDE analysis, self-managed static analysis and cloud-based analysis for continuous integration and delivery pipelines. Sonar can be integrated with tools like GitHub, Bitbucket, Azure DevOps and GitLab so developers can keep their code clean and maintain quality without having to spend time on it.
If you want to have security context in the foreground as you write code, DryRun Security offers a plug-in that can give you fast and accurate security code reviews. Its AI-powered Security Buddy uses contextual security analysis to assess pull requests and factors like authentication and authorization, and sensitive code paths. It works with multiple languages and frameworks and is installed as a GitHub App for immediate use.
If you want to automate some of the design process to avoid technical debt, Agentic Labs offers an AI-powered editor that's integrated with the codebase. It can generate design documents based on project goals and help with deeper design exploration. It offers real-time collaboration, risk highlighting and an AI chat for explanations and alternative exploration, and can help with technical design and software development.